Hardscape Construction in Fairfield County, CT
Hardscape construction services encompass the design and installation of durable, aesthetically appealing features that enhance outdoor living spaces. This includes projects such as pat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or kitchens. Property owners often seek these services to improve functionality, create inviting gathering areas, or add visual interest to their yards. Before requesting hardscape work, it’s helpful to consider the desired purpose of the project, the materials preferred, and any specific design elements or styles that complement the existing landscape.
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including material options, estimated durability, and maintenance requirements. It’s also important to evaluate the existing landscape and soil conditions to ensure the design will be stable and long-lasting. Clarifying budget expectations and any local building codes or permits required can help streamline the process. Contacting experienced professionals can provide guidance on suitable materials and design ideas that align with the property’s layout and aesthetic goals.

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are included in hardscape construction? Hardscape construction covers features like pat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or living spaces designed with durable materials.
How long do hardscape features typically last? Properly installed hardscape elements can last for decades with minimal maintenance, depending on materials used.
What materials are commonly used in hardscape construction? Common materials include concrete, brick, stone, and pavers, chosen for their durability and aesthetic appeal.
What should property owners consider before starting a hardscape project? It's important to plan for proper drainage, site conditions, and the overall design to ensure long-lasting results.
